Healthcare expenditure accounts for a significant portion of global GDP, around 10%. The number is significantly larger for countries like the US. The cost will likely trend higher as larger numbers of people suffer from chronic conditions, leading to longer hospitalization times and increasing care requirements. Globally, there is a dearth of hospital beds and qualified doctors. Critical care waiting times are on the rise.
Healthcare needs a transformation to become more sustainable and accessible.

Wearable Multi Parameter Monitor
The wearable monitor is a smart solution that can be adopted for Remote Critical
Care Monitoring, Home Based Monitoring or Assisted Living.
◘ Wearable multi parameter
monitoring solution for on-the-move
monitoring
◘ Integrated ECG, Respiration and
Temperature sensors
◘ Integrated wireless connectivity
(BLE/WiFi) for data upload to cloud
◘ Integrated data storage
◘ Remote Patient Monitoring through
remote viewers using Android, iOS
devices
◘ Integrated accelerometer for patient
movement, fall detection and
posture tracking
◘ Hot Keys for SOS and event marking

4. Remote Specialist
The solution takes specialist care to even remote locations through IP camera
enabled Tele-consultations using real time video streaming. It enables remote
decision making support for a patient admitted at a remote nodal centre. It offers
a convenient way for remotely located specialists to call up patient records and
radiology reports from nodal centers where the patient is admitted to diagnose
conditions and provide specialist care.
◘ Real time live video streaming for
tele-consultation
◘ 2 way video consultation and
message exchange
◘ Remote camera control facility like
zoom, pan and tilt
◘ Display of vital parameters like
SpO2, NIBP, RR, HR
◘ Limit settings, alerts and alarms
notification
◘ DICOM viewer for radiology reports
◘ Video storage and vital data archival
◘ Integration with bedside PMS for
auto vital data acquisition
◘ Integration with X-Ray modality for
report sharing
